forked from: PopUpAnchorを使ってみた

by marcsali forked from PopUpAnchorを使ってみた (diff: 89)
♥0 | Line 78 | Modified 2013-02-11 19:01:29 | MIT License
play

ActionScript3 source code

/**
 * Copyright marcsali ( http://wonderfl.net/user/marcsali )
 * MIT License ( http://www.opensource.org/licenses/mit-license.php )
 * Downloaded from: http://wonderfl.net/c/kDHU
 */

<?xml version="1.0" encoding="utf-8"?>
<s:Application xmlns:fx="http://ns.adobe.com/mxml/2009" 
               xmlns:s="library://ns.adobe.com/flex/spark" 
               xmlns:mx="library://ns.adobe.com/flex/mx">
<fx:Style>
        @namespace s "library://ns.adobe.com/flex/spark";
        @namespace mx "library://ns.adobe.com/flex/mx";                   
         
        s|RichText#cvCorps { 
              color: green;    
             }       
</fx:Style> 
      
        <fx:Declarations>
        <s:Animate id="animate1" target="{lm}">
            <s:SimpleMotionPath property="x"  valueFrom="0" valueTo="200"/>
        </s:Animate>
        <s:Animate id="animate2" target="{lm}">
            <s:SimpleMotionPath property="x"  valueFrom="0" valueTo="200"/>
        </s:Animate>
        <s:Animate id="animate3" target="{cv}">
            <s:SimpleMotionPath property="y"  valueFrom="0" valueTo="200"/>
        </s:Animate>
        
        <s:TextFlow id="titreLm">
        <s:p fontSize="16" color="red" textIndent="20" textAlign="justify"> 
            Je me présente à vous, Actuellement en deuxème année à l'Université de Caen,
            je suis à la recehrche d'un travail travail dans l'encadrement et de
            soutien scolaire auprès des jeunes de niveau collège et lycée sur Caen
            et son agglomération, 
            
        </s:p> 
         <s:br/>
        </s:TextFlow>
        <s:TextFlow id="corpsLm" >
       <s:p textAlign="justify">ffffffffffffffffffffffffffffffffffff, 
      consectetuer adipiscing elit. Praesent aliquam, justo convallis 
      luctus rutrum, erat nulla fermentum diam, at nonummy quam ante ac 
      quam.</s:p>
      <s:p textAlign="justify">Maecenas urna purus, 
      fermentum id, molestie in, commodo porttitor, felis. Nam blandit quam 
      ut lacus. Quisque ornare risus quis ligula.</s:p>
 
        </s:TextFlow>
        <s:TextFlow id="titreCv">
        </s:TextFlow>
        <s:TextFlow id="corpsCv">
               <s:p textAlign="justify">ffffffffffffffffffffffffffffffffffff, 
      consectetuer adipiscing elit. Praesent aliquam, justo convallis 
      luctus rutrum, erat nulla fermentum diam, at nonummy quam ante ac 
      quam.</s:p>
      <s:p textAlign="justify">Maecenas urna purus, 
      fermentum id, molestie in, commodo porttitor, felis. Nam blandit quam 
      ut lacus. Quisque ornare risus quis ligula.</s:p>

        </s:TextFlow>                 
    </fx:Declarations>
     
    <s:Panel width="100%" height="100%"  title="Candidature">
    <s:HGroup id="tot"   x="30%" y="80%" width="10%" height="5%">
        <s:Button label="Présentation"  click="pop1.displayPopUp=true"/>         
        <s:Button label="LM"  click="pop2.displayPopUp=true"/>
        <s:Button label="CV"  click="pop3.displayPopUp=true"/>
    </s:HGroup> 
    
    <s:PopUpAnchor id="pop1"   y="100"  width="100%" height="100%">
        <s:TitleWindow id="pre"  title="Présentation" addedEffect="{animate1}"
                width="300" height="180" close="pop1.displayPopUp=false"> 
          </s:TitleWindow> 
    </s:PopUpAnchor>    
  
    <s:PopUpAnchor id="pop2"   y="100"  width="100%" height="100%">
        <s:TitleWindow id="lm"  title="Lettre de Motivation" addedEffect="{animate2}"
                width="300" height="180" close="pop2.displayPopUp=false"> 
         <s:RichText  id="lmTitre"   textFlow="{titreLm}" width="250" />
         <s:RichText  id="lmCorps"   textFlow="{corpsLm}" width="250" />          
         </s:TitleWindow> 
    </s:PopUpAnchor>
 
    <s:PopUpAnchor id="pop3" popUpPosition="center" width="100%" height="100%">
        <s:TitleWindow  id="cv" title="Curriculum Vitae" addedEffect="{animate3}"
            width="300" height="180" close="pop3.displayPopUp=false">
          <s:RichText  id="cvTitre"   textFlow="{titreCv}"  width="250" />
          <s:RichText  id="cvCorps"   textFlow="{corpsCv}"  width="250" />          
        </s:TitleWindow> 
    </s:PopUpAnchor>
    </s:Panel>
</s:Application>